Track Times *UPDATED*
Ok so yesterday I was able to make 4 passes and what a huge difference the slicks made.
First pass I messed up a little, I was kinda freaked out by the difference that the slicks made and It felt a little different so I was more or less feeling it out, 14.051 @ 99
Second Pass is where it started to get good. I was shifting at 5300-5500 RPM launching at 3500 in first. 13.950 @ 100
Third Pass I was racing a buddy of mine, he has a notch with a 306, AFR 165's, Comp Cam, BBK Shorties, and a Edlebrock Performer RPM intake, 3.55 gears, Alum Driveshaft, 5 speed, Street Tires. This is where I ran my best pass, Launched at 3700 RPM, hammered through the gears, shifted at 5000-5200 RPM:
RT: .056
60': 1.819
330': 5.873
1/8: 8.989
MPH: 81.439
1000': 11.081
1/4: 13.297
MPH: 105
Then The last pass my buddy and I were racing again and I missed third and ended up with a 14.1.
All in all it was a good time, I had alot more fun this time than I did a week ago, I think this car has the potential for 12's with a little more tuning, I am going to get a Tweecer RT This week and start doing a little logging and watching the A/F to get it set perfect. I am venturing to say I can see a 12.9 out of this car.

I was running the slicks at 20 psi to start and bled them down to 15psi. I cant believe it was hooking at those high rpm launches. I need to practice the launches i think because three of the 4 passes the motor bogged when I dumped the clutch, so i think that with a little trial and error, I can get it to rocket out of the hole.
The downside to the whole event is that I will need a new water pump after last night. which bothers me because of all the work i just put into this motor. When I rebuilt it completely a year ago I put a new pump on it, I drove it here and there over the course of a year and put 500 miles on it, then i pulled it out again to put the heads, cam, roller rockers, etc in. When I had everything apart and was cleaning everything, I pulled the back plate off the water pump and destroyed the gasket that goes between the water pump and the plate. I had the gasket that goes between the plate and the timing cover so I decided that I would just silicone the plate back to the pump, well now its pissing out a little bit of coolant when it gets pressure in there. Its just one of those things you have to deal with when doing an engine I guess.
